Afcon 2023: Super Eagles may face Senegal, Cameroon, and Guinea in the round of 16.

The Super Eagles booked their place in the Round of 16 on Monday night at the ongoing 2023 Africa Cup of Nations, Afcon.

Jose Peseiro’s side defeated Guinea-Bissau 1-0, thanks to an own goal from Opa Sangante in the first half.

The result means Nigeria finished in second position in Group A behind leaders, Equatorial Guinea, who thrashed the host nation Cote d’Ivoire.

 Nigeria will now face the second-place team in Group C in Round 16 on Saturday night.

Senegal is currently at the top of Group C with six points, while Guinea is in second position with four points.

Cameroon has one point, while Gambia has lost all their matches so far.

The last fixtures in Group C will see Senegal tackle Guinea and Cameroon play Gambia.

Group C fixtures will take place on Tuesday evening.

 This means Nigeria could face either Senegal, Guinea, or Cameroon in the last 16 depending on the outcome of Group C final matches.

Nigeria have won two, lost one, and drawn one of their four matches against Senegal in the past.

The Super Eagles have won two, lost two, and drew two out of the six matches they played against Guinea.

Against Cameroon, Nigeria has won four, lost two, and drawn one of the seven matches they played against the Indomitable Lions in the past.
